When we last saw John Wick in Chapter 4 last year, the fate of the assassin looked fairly cut and dry and there were a lot of questions over whether we would ever see him again.
However, we should all know by now, you can't keep John Wick down, as it's been confirmed that Keanu Reeves will return as the iconic character for the upcoming spinoff movie Ballerina.
The flick starring Ana De Armas is set in the fictional world of John Wick, in between the events of the third and fourth movie.
De Armas stars as a ballerina-assassin called Rooney, who is on a mission to hunt down those who killed her family.
The explosive new trailer, which has not been released to the public yet, premiered at CinemaCon this week in Las Vegas, with Variety reporting that Reeves shows up in the clip.
“How do I start doing what you do?” De Armas' character asks the legendary hit man, to which he replies: “Looks like you already have."
Reeves’ appearance in the trailer reportedly drew loud applause from the crowd, and the clip provided plenty of action from De Armas including "torching a truck with a flamethrower, leaping from moving vehicles and engaging in brutal hand-to-hand combat in a burning building."
Ballerina has a stacked supporting cast including Anjelica Huston, Gabriel Byrne, Norman Reedus, Ian McShane, and Lance Reddick in his last on-screen appearance after his untimely death last year.
Officially announced in April 2022, Ballerina has had its release date delayed to June 6, 2025 for additional shooting.
Lionsgate motion picture group chair Adam Fogelson said "the filmmakers were given the opportunity to add significant set pieces to the film."
